      <content:encoded xmlns="http://purl.org/rss/1.0/modules/content/"><![CDATA[<p>Prime Minister Imran Khan formally launched Ehsaas "Koi Bhooka Na Soye" initiative at a cermony in Islamabad on Wednesday.</p>

<p>Under the initiative, cooked meals will be provided through mobile  trucks at designated delivery points to people in need especially those at risk of or experiencing hunger.</p>

<p>Initially, the Ehsaas Food Trucks are being operated in Islamabad and Rawalpindi and at later stage this programme will be further expanded to other parts of the country.</p>

<p>Addressing the launching ceremony, Prime Minister Imran Khan said the programme is a step towards a welfare state, which always cares for its poor and deserving people.</p>

<p>He said he always feels happy to see that deserving people are given shelter and food with honour and dignity at various Panahgahs established across the country.</p>

<p>The Prime Minister also announced to launch a subsidy programme by June this year under which money will directly be transferred to the accounts of 30 million families.</p>

<p>He said it will enable the poor and deserving people to procure kitchen items.</p>

<p>The Prime Minister said similarly direct subsidy will be provided to farmers so that they can procure fertilizers and other agricultural inputs.</p>

<p>Briefing the Prime Minister, Special Assistant on Poverty Alleviation Dr Sania Nishtar said this programme is being executed with the cooperation of Pakistan Bait-ul-Maal.</p>

<p>Managing Director, Pakistan Bait-ul-Maal Aon Abbas Bappi on this occasion said that hospitals and bus stops are especially targeted so that quality meals can be served to the deserving people.</p>
